Control Neovim instances using "nvr" commandline tool

Project description

nvr is a tool that helps controlling nvim processes.

It basically does two things:

  1. adds back the --remote family of options (see man vim)

  2. helps controlling the current nvim from within :terminal

To target a certain nvim process, you either use the --servername option or set the environment variable $NVIM_LISTEN_ADDRESS.

Since $NVIM_LISTEN_ADDRESS is implicitely set by each nvim process, you can call nvr from within Neovim (:terminal) without specifying --servername.
